Systems
Basic Teletilt
®
RET System
A basic RET system includes a controller, actuators attached to antennas, and control cable.
Multiple actuators can be joined together by daisy-chaining control cables or by using a junction box.
Electrical tilt adjustments can be made remotely from the BTS using a portable or rack mount controller or over a network using a rack mount controller.
Teletilt
®
RET System Using Smart Bias Tees
Reduces the number of cable runs leading up a tower by injecting the AISG control signal onto an existing RF coaxial line using a smart bias tee.
Smart bias tee is used at the bottom of the tower and either a smart bias tee or an AISG tower mounted amplifier (TMA) is used at the top of the tower to restore the control signal back onto a control cable feeding to the actuator attached to an antenna.
Teletilt
®
RET System Using dc 2.1 Bias Tees
By using the SMB ports on the ATC300-1000 Teletilt® controller, a dc 2.1 bias tee can be used at the bottom of the tower in place of a smart bias tee.
With an SMB to SMA coaxial cable connected to the SMB port of the controller at one end and to a dc 2.1 bias tee at the other end, the AISG control signal is injected onto the RF coaxial line leading up the tower.
Either a smart bias tee or an AISG tower mounted amplifier (TMA) is used at the top of the tower to split the control signal out to the control cables feeding into the actuators.
